Taking everything into account, PNC scores 3 out of 10 in our fundamental rating. PNC was compared to 392 industry peers in the Banks industry. While PNC is still in line with the averages on profitability rating, there are concerns on its financial health. PNC has a decent growth rate and is not valued too expensively.

2.2 Solvency

The Debt to FCF ratio of PNC is 7.00, which is on the high side as it means it would take PNC, 7.00 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
PNC has a worse Debt to FCF ratio (7.00) than 72.70% of its industry peers.
PNC has a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.74. This is a neutral value indicating PNC is somewhat dependend on debt financing.
PNC's Debt to Equity ratio of 0.74 is on the low side compared to the rest of the industry. PNC is outperformed by 80.87% of its industry peers.

5. Dividend

5.1 Amount

With a Yearly Dividend Yield of 3.35%, PNC has a reasonable but not impressive dividend return.
Compared to an average industry Dividend Yield of 3.73, PNC has a dividend in line with its industry peers.
Compared to an average S&P500 Dividend Yield of 2.38, PNC pays a bit more dividend than the S&P500 average.

5.2 History

On average, the dividend of PNC grows each year by 8.73%, which is quite nice.
PNC has been paying a dividend for at least 10 years, so it has a reliable track record.
PNC has not decreased its dividend for at least 10 years, so it has a reliable track record of non decreasing dividend.

5.3 Sustainability

49.74% of the earnings are spent on dividend by PNC. This is a bit on the high side, but may be sustainable.
The dividend of PNC is growing, but the earnings are growing slower. This means the dividend growth is not sustainable.
